diff options
author | Pierre-Emmanuel Patry <pierre-emmanuel.patry@embecosm.com> | 2023-08-03 15:28:40 +0200 |
---|---|---|
committer | Philip Herron <philip.herron@embecosm.com> | 2023-08-17 10:01:43 +0000 |
commit | c5326821d396599a12b3f1293229e943a95f29be (patch) | |
tree | bb09743dac9f19658c878d4d74f76bec3023a102 /gcc/rust/backend | |
parent | 294c5906d7b6e9f7a89e58c334f0072f98b679c6 (diff) | |
download | gcc-c5326821d396599a12b3f1293229e943a95f29be.zip gcc-c5326821d396599a12b3f1293229e943a95f29be.tar.gz gcc-c5326821d396599a12b3f1293229e943a95f29be.tar.bz2 |
fix lexer exponent output on tuple indices
The lexer did output a literal for values such as 42.e wich are invalid
in rust.
gcc/rust/ChangeLog:
* lex/rust-lex.cc (Lexer::parse_decimal_int_or_float): Only
accept digits after a dot instead of accepting any float
member.
Signed-off-by: Pierre-Emmanuel Patry <pierre-emmanuel.patry@embecosm.com>
Diffstat (limited to 'gcc/rust/backend')
0 files changed, 0 insertions, 0 deletions